Transaction

fc8e16d737913b4e20898e6c6077f3740584549ac9e95069c56f0c3ba983706b

Summary

In Block23937
TimeSat, 21 Jan 2023 08:02:00 UTC
Total Input2451.98064949 Nebula
Total Output2451.98049709 Nebula
Fees0.0001524 Nebula

Details

Raw Transaction